1 MONCRIF CLOSE is a large extended detached house of 154m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£931,511. It was last sold for £590,000 in May 2014, which was around 47% above the average May 2014 detached price in the Maidstone local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was September 2013,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

1 MONCRIF C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Maidstone local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 1 MONCRIF CLOSE sales between September 1997 and May 2014 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the February 2008 sale was for 31%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 31% above the HPI over time, until the May 2014 sale, where it rises to 47%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 47% above the HPI.

What might 1 MONCRIF CLOSE be worth now?

1 MONCRIF C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£931,511.

This is based on house price inflation of 57.9%, between May 2014 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Maidstone local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 57.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 1 MONCRIF CLOSE of £590,000 on 9th May 2014. For the value to have increased from £590,000 to £931,511 over the eleven years and three months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 1 MONCRIF C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Maidstone local authority area.
  • The May 2014 sale price of £590,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 1 MONCRIF CLOSE has not materially changed since May 2014.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

How Large is 1 MONCRIF CLOSE?

1 MONCRIF CLOSE is 154m², which includes two extensions, according to the EPC inspection conducted in September 2013. This puts it in the largest 40% of detached houses houses in Bearsted,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ses houses by size in Bearsted, and where 1 MONCRIF CLOSE lies on this distribution: 68% of detached houses houses are smaller than 1 MONCRIF CLOSE, and 32%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Bearsted.

1 MONCRIF C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

1 MONCRIF C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.128 of an acre, or 518m². The below map shows the location of 1 MONCRIF C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 1 MONCRIF C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
